Hören Sie auf, sich zu wiederholen: Wie Claude Skills meinen KI-Entwicklungsworkflow verändert hat
„Können Sie unsere TypeScript-Konventionen befolgen? Verwenden Sie Suspense zum Laden von Zuständen. Vergessen Sie nicht die MUI v7-Syntax. Oh, und stellen Sie sicher, dass –“
Ich muss in meiner ersten Woche mit Claude Code fünfzig Mal Variationen davon getippt haben.
Jede neue Chat-Sitzung. Jede neue Komponente. Immer wieder die gleichen Anweisungen. Kopieren und Einfügen aus meinem Notizendokument. Ich hoffe, ich habe nichts Wichtiges verpasst. Ich habe beobachtet, wie Claude gelegentlich von unseren Mustern abweicht, weil ich vergessen habe, dieses entscheidende Detail zu erwähnen.
Es musste einen besseren Weg geben.
Die Wiederholungssteuer
Das Besondere an der Arbeit mit KI-Assistenten ist, dass sie unglaublich leistungsfähig sind, sich aber den Kontext zwischen den Sitzungen nicht merken können. Dieser Neuanfang ist normalerweise ein Feature und kein Fehler. Bis Ihnen klar wird, dass Sie 20 % Ihrer Zeit damit verbringen, Ihr Setup noch einmal zu erklären.
Ich habe täglich beobachtet, wie unser Team damit zu kämpfen hat:
- Sarah kopiert und fügt in jede Eingabeaufforderung dieselben Reaktionsmuster ein
- Mike erklärt zum zehnten Mal in dieser Woche unsere API-Konventionen
- Jenny verbringt Stunden damit, verstreute Notizen in Blogbeiträge umzuwandeln
- Ich erinnere Claude ständig an unsere Codierungsstandards
Wir behandelten Claude wie einen talentierten Praktikanten, der über Nacht alles vergisst.
Das Problem war nicht Claude. So haben wir es genutzt.
Was sind eigentlich Claude-Fähigkeiten?
Claude Skills sind wiederverwendbare Eingabeaufforderungen und Workflows, die sich im Verzeichnis „.claude/skills/“ Ihres Projekts befinden.
Stellen Sie sich das so vor: Anstatt Ihre Anforderungen jedes Mal zu erklären, erstellen Sie eine Fertigkeit nur einmal. Dann rufen Sie es mit „@skill-name“ auf, wann immer Sie es brauchen. Claude liest die Anweisungen und den Kontext des Skills und wendet sie dann auf Ihre spezifische Anfrage an.
Bei jedem Skill handelt es sich normalerweise um eine „SKILL.md“-Datei, die Folgendes enthält:
- Rollendefinitionen und Kontext
- Best Practices und Muster
- Beispiele und Richtlinien
- Referenzmaterialien
- Spezifische Anweisungen für die Aufgabendomäne
Aber das macht sie so leistungsstark: Sie sind zusammensetzbar, gemeinsam nutzbar und persistent. Einmal erstellen, für immer nutzen. Teilen Sie es mit Ihrem Team. Kombinieren Sie mehrere Fähigkeiten in komplexen Arbeitsabläufen.
Es ist, als ob man über eine Bibliothek mit Fachberatern auf Abruf verfügt, von denen jeder auf sein Fachgebiet spezialisiert ist.
Die vier Fähigkeiten, die alles verändert haben
Ich begann mit vier Fähigkeiten, die meiner tatsächlichen Arbeit entsprachen:
1. Frontend-Entwicklungsrichtlinien
Mein „@frontend-dev-guidelines“-Skill weiß alles über unseren React-Stack: TypeScript-Muster, Suspense-Grenzen, useSuspenseQuery zum Datenabruf, MUI v7-Syntax, TanStack-Router-Setup und Leistungsoptimierung.
Vorher: „Erstellen Sie eine Benutzerprofilkomponente mit … [500 Wörter Erklärung]“
Nachher: „Erstellen Sie eine Benutzerprofilkomponente“ + „@frontend-dev-guidelines“.
Der Skill stellt den gesamten Kontext bereit. Claude generiert Code, der unseren Mustern entspricht. Erster Versuch. Jedes Mal.
2. Verfasser von Blogbeiträgen
Ich sammle die ganze Woche über verstreute Gedanken. Zufällige Beobachtungen. Technische Erkenntnisse. Aufzählungspunkte in Apple Notes. Bisher dauerte es vier bis sechs Stunden, daraus einen zusammenhängenden Blog-Beitrag zu erstellen.
Jetzt? Ich speichere alles in „@blog-post-writer“.
Es strukturiert das Chaos. Fügt einen Erzählfluss hinzu. Behält die Stimmkonsistenz bei. Enthält spezifische Details. Schafft ansprechende Eröffnungen und überzeugende Schlussfolgerungen.
Die Schreibsitzungen am Freitagnachmittag verliefen anstrengend und vergnüglich.
3. Content-Trendforscher
Bevor ich einen neuen Blogbeitrag oder eine neue Videoserie starte, benötige ich Marktforschung. Was ist im Trend? Wonach suchen die Leute? Wo gibt es inhaltliche Lücken?
„@content-trend-researcher“ analysiert Google Trends, Reddit, YouTube, Medium, LinkedIn und acht weitere Plattformen. Es bietet Daten zum Suchvolumen, eine Analyse der Benutzerabsichten, die Identifizierung von Inhaltslücken und SEO-optimierte Artikelumrisse.
Was früher drei Tage manueller Recherche erforderte, dauert jetzt 30 Minuten.
4. Effektive Aufforderungen schreiben
Dies ist ein Meta, aber entscheidend: „@writing-efficient-prompts“ zeigt Ihnen, wie Sie bessere Eingabeaufforderungen strukturieren.
Der Schwerpunkt liegt auf rollenbasierter Eingabeaufforderung, expliziten Anweisungen, positivem Framing, XML-Tag-Strukturierung und Beispielausrichtung. Es ist, als ob ein technischer Coach sofort zur Verfügung steht.
Ich verwende es, wenn ich komplexe Aufgaben bewältige, die ich noch nie zuvor erledigt habe. Es hilft mir, die Eingabeaufforderung beim ersten Mal richtig zu strukturieren.
Echte Probleme, echte Lösungen
Ich zeige Ihnen, wie das in der Praxis aussieht.
Problem 1: Der Copy-Paste-Albtraum
Vorkenntnisse:
Jedes Mal, wenn ich eine React-Komponente erstellt habe, habe ich Folgendes aus meinen Notizen kopiert und eingefügt:
„ Verwenden Sie TypeScript mit React.FC Lazy Load mit React.lazy(), wenn es schwer ist Wickeln Sie SuspenseLoader ein, um Zustände zu laden Verwenden Sie useSuspenseQuery zum Abrufen von Daten Stil mit MUI v7 (Grid size={{ xs: 12, md: 6 }} Syntax) Keine vorzeitigen Rückgaben mit Ladespinnern Wenden Sie useCallback für Ereignishandler an, die an untergeordnete Elemente übergeben werden „
Ich würde Gegenstände vergessen. Überspringen Sie Schritte, wenn Sie in Eile sind. Erhalten Sie inkonsistente Ergebnisse.
Nach Fertigkeiten:
„ @frontend-dev-guidelines
Erstellen Sie eine Produktkartenkomponente, die Produktinformationen mit der Schaltfläche „In den Warenkorb“ anzeigt „
Claude wendet alle unsere Muster automatisch an. Konsistente Ausgabe. Kein Kopieren und Einfügen.
Problem 2: Blog-Post-Lähmung
Vorkenntnisse:
Ich hatte 47 Notizdateien mit Ideen für Blogbeiträge. Teilweise mit ein paar Stichpunkten. Andere mit weitschweifigen Absätzen. Keine veröffentlicht.
Die Kluft zwischen „verstreuten Gedanken“ und „veröffentlichungsfertigem Beitrag“ fühlte sich unüberwindbar an. Ich starrte auf die Notizen und wusste nicht, wo ich anfangen sollte. Die meisten Ideen erblickten nie das Licht der Welt.
Nach Fertigkeiten:
Freitagnachmittage wurden zu Verlagstagen. Ich würde die Notizen der Woche sammeln und sie in „@blog-post-writer“ ablegen:
„ Zufällige Gedanken zum Wechsel zu TanStack Query:
- Redux fühlte sich beim Datenabruf wie ein Overkill an
- Zu viel Boilerplate
- Der Cache-First-Click von TanStack Query wurde sofort angeklickt
- useSuspenseQuery hat die Komplexität des Ladezustands beseitigt
- Die Leistung hat sich spürbar verbessert
- Code um ca. 40 % reduziert
- Ich wünschte, ich hätte früher gewechselt „
Herausgekommen ist ein ausgefeilter Beitrag mit angemessener Struktur, ansprechender Erzählung und technischer Tiefe. Der Skill übernimmt die Transformation. Ich kümmere mich um die einzigartigen Erkenntnisse.
Veröffentlichte Beiträge: 47 → 23 (Tendenz steigend).
Problem 3: Die Onboarding-Lücke
Vorkenntnisse:
Neues Teammitglied kommt hinzu. Verbringt die erste Woche damit, unsere Konventionen zu lernen. Liest Dokumentation. Stellt Fragen. Produziert immer noch Code, der nicht unseren Mustern entspricht. Code-Reviews werden zu Lehrveranstaltungen.
Wir waren nicht gemein. Sie hatten einfach noch nicht den Kontext.
Nach Fertigkeiten:
Der erste Tag des neuen Teamkollegen: „Hier ist unser Kompetenzverzeichnis. Verwenden Sie „@frontend-dev-guidelines“ für jede React-Arbeit. Verwenden Sie „@writing-efficient-prompts“, wenn Sie bei komplexen Eingabeaufforderungen nicht weiterkommen.“
Sie sind sofort produktiv. Codeüberprüfungen konzentrieren sich auf die Geschäftslogik und nicht auf Stildebatten. Die Fähigkeiten stellen automatisch institutionelles Wissen bereit.
Wie Fähigkeiten tatsächlich funktionieren
Die technische Umsetzung ist elegant schlicht.
Verzeichnisstruktur: „ Dein-Projekt/ └── .claude/ └── Fähigkeiten/ ├── frontend-dev-guidelines/ │ ├── SKILL.md │ └── Ressourcen/ │ ├── Component-Patterns.md │ ├── data-fetching.md │ └── Styling-Guide.md └── Blog-Post-Autor/ ├── SKILL.md └── Referenzen/ ├── voice-tone.md └── story-circle.md „
Aufruf: Wenn Sie „@frontend-dev-guidelines“ eingeben, liest Claude Code die Datei SKILL.md und alle referenzierten Ressourcen. Dieser Inhalt wird Teil des Kontexts für dieses Gespräch.
Die Magie: Sie ändern Claudes Verhalten nicht wirklich. Sie stellen einen konsistenten, qualitativ hochwertigen Kontext bereit, dessen manuelle Eingabe jedes Mal mühsam wäre.
Bei Fertigkeiten handelt es sich im Wesentlichen um erweiterte Eingabeaufforderungsvorlagen mit Organisation.
Aber die Auswirkungen? Transformativ.
Erste Schritte: Ihre ersten Fähigkeiten
Woche 1: Installieren und testen
Beginnen Sie mit 2-3 vorgefertigten Fertigkeiten vom Skills Marketplace (skillsmp.com) oder GitHub. Ich habe unter github.com/mejba13/awesome-claude-skills eine kuratierte Sammlung mit 4 produktionsbereiten Fertigkeiten erstellt, die Sie sofort nutzen können:
- Finden Sie Fähigkeiten, die für Ihre tägliche Arbeit relevant sind
- Laden Sie es nach „.claude/skills/“ herunter
- Probieren Sie sie an echten Aufgaben aus
- Beachten Sie, was funktioniert und was nicht
Ich begann mit „Frontend-Dev-Guidelines“ und „Blog-Post-Writer“. Beide sofort wertvoll.
Woche 2: Erstellen Sie einen benutzerdefinierten Skill
Identifizieren Sie Ihre am häufigsten wiederholte Erklärung. Das Ding, das man ständig kopiert, einfügt oder neu tippt.
Erstellen Sie „.claude/skills/my-first-skill/SKILL.md“:
„Abschlag
Name: API-Muster meiner Firma Beschreibung: Unsere API-Konventionen, Fehlerbehandlung und Antwortformate
Unternehmens-API-Muster
Beim Erstellen von API-Endpunkten:
-
Antwortformat: – Immer { Erfolg: boolean, Daten: beliebig, Fehler?: Zeichenfolge } zurückgeben
- Verwenden Sie die richtigen HTTP-Statuscodes
- Fügen Sie die Anforderungs-ID in die Header ein
-
Fehlerbehandlung:
- Erfassen Sie alle Fehler auf Routenebene
- Loggen Sie sich mit unserem Logging-Service ein
- Geben Sie niemals interne Fehlerdetails preis
-
Authentifizierung:
- Validieren Sie JWT auf geschützten Routen
- Überprüfen Sie die Benutzerberechtigungen
- Ratenbegrenzung nach Benutzer-ID
[Fügen Sie hier Ihre spezifischen Muster hinzu] „
Testen Sie es. Verfeinern Sie es. Teilen Sie es mit Ihrem Team.
Woche 3: Workflows erstellen
Kombinieren Sie mehrere Fähigkeiten für komplexe Aufgaben:
„
Pipeline zur Inhaltserstellung
- @content-trend-researcher – Recherchieren Sie Trendthemen
- Sammeln Sie persönliche Erfahrungen und Erkenntnisse
- @blog-post-writer – In einen Blog-Beitrag verwandeln
- @frontend-dev-guidelines – Begleitende Demo erstellen
- Veröffentlichen Sie mit Codebeispielen „
Woche 4: Teampraktiken etablieren
- Teilen Sie Ihre besten Fähigkeiten im Team-Repo
- Schaffen Sie Fähigkeiten für teamweite Tagungen
- Dokumentieren Sie, welche Fähigkeiten für welche Aufgaben eingesetzt werden sollen
- Iterieren Sie basierend auf dem, was tatsächlich hilft
Die Fähigkeiten, die ich mir gewünscht hätte
Nach drei Monaten mit Fähigkeiten denke ich als nächstes über Folgendes nach:
API-Dokumentationsgenerator Eingabe: API-Endpunktcode Ausgabe: OpenAPI-Spezifikation + Anwendungsbeispiele + Integrationshandbücher
Testfallautor Eingabe: Komponente oder Funktion Ausgabe: Umfassende Testsuite mit Randfällen
Checkliste zur Codeüberprüfung Eingabe: Pull-Request-Diff Ergebnis: Strukturierte Überprüfung gemäß Teamstandards
Datenbankschema-Designer Eingabe: Funktionsanforderungen Ausgabe: Optimiertes Schema + Migrationen + Indizes
Das Schöne an Fähigkeiten: Wenn Sie sie brauchen, können Sie sie aufbauen.
Was ich gelernt habe (auf die harte Tour)
Fähigkeiten sind keine Zauberei: Sie sind so gut wie die Anweisungen, die Sie geben. Vage Fähigkeiten = vage Ergebnisse. Spezifische Fähigkeiten = spezifische Ergebnisse.
Investieren Sie im Vorfeld Zeit, um Ihre Muster klar zu dokumentieren.
Einfach beginnen: Mein erster benutzerdefinierter Skill bestand aus 100 Zeilen weitschweifigem Text. Claude war verwirrt. Ich war frustriert.
Habe es umgeschrieben: klare Abschnitte, konkrete Beispiele, explizite Anweisungen. Sofort bessere Ergebnisse.
Versionskontrolle Ihrer Fähigkeiten: Die Fähigkeiten entwickeln sich mit der Weiterentwicklung Ihrer Praktiken. Verpflichte sie zu Git. Verfolgen Sie Änderungen. Teilen Sie es mit Ihrem Team.
Nicht alles erfordert eine Fähigkeit: Einmalige Aufgaben? Einfach normal auffordern. Fähigkeiten glänzen bei sich wiederholenden Mustern und komplexen Zusammenhängen.
Die Zukunft ist kontextabhängig
Folgendes wurde mir nach drei Monaten klar:
Der wirkungsvollste Aspekt ist nicht das Einsparen von Tipparbeit. Es ist Konsistenz.
Vor Skills war jede Interaktion mit Claude ein Neuanfang. Manchmal trafen wir genau den Punkt, an dem wir perfekte Anweisungen erhielten. Zu anderen Zeiten nicht so sehr. Die Qualität variierte stark.
Mit Fähigkeiten ist die Qualität gleichbleibend. Das Team folgt den gleichen Mustern. Neue Mitglieder kommen schneller hinzu. Codeüberprüfungen konzentrieren sich auf die Geschäftslogik.
Wir nutzen nicht nur KI-Tools. Wir bauen institutionelles Wissen auf, das sich im Laufe der Zeit verdichtet.
Du bist dran
Wenn Sie Claude Code (oder einen anderen KI-Assistenten) verwenden und feststellen, dass Sie dieselben Anweisungen wiederholen, benötigen Sie Fähigkeiten.
Diese Woche:
- Identifizieren Sie Ihre am häufigsten wiederholte Erklärung
- Einen Skill dafür erstellen (15 Minuten)
- Nutzen Sie es für jede relevante Aufgabe
- Verfeinern Sie basierend auf den Ergebnissen
Diesen Monat:
- Installieren Sie 2-3 Community-Skills
- Erstellen Sie 2-3 benutzerdefinierte Fähigkeiten für Ihren Workflow
- Teilen Sie es mit einem Teamkollegen
- Erstellen Sie Ihren ersten Multi-Skill-Workflow
Dieses Quartal:
- Erstellen Sie eine Teamfähigkeitsbibliothek
- Dokumentieren Sie, welche Fähigkeiten welche Probleme lösen
- Integrieren Sie neue Teammitglieder mit Fähigkeiten
- Tragen Sie etwas zur Community bei
Die Werkzeuge sind da. Die Community wächst. Die Frage ist nur: Wie lange willst du dich noch wiederholen?
Ressourcen
Erste Schritte:
- Skills Marketplace – Community-Skills durchsuchen – Claude Code-Dokumentation – Offizielle Leitfäden
- Awesome Claude Skills – Kuratierte Skill-Sammlung mit 4 produktionsbereiten Skills
Beliebte Fähigkeiten zum Ausprobieren:
- „frontend-dev-guidelines“ – Best Practices für React/TypeScript
- „Blog-Post-Writer“ – Verwandeln Sie Notizen in Beiträge
- „Content-Trend-Researcher“ – Multiplattform-Trendanalyse
- „Writing-Effective-Prompts“ – Prompt-Engineering-Leitfaden
Bauen Sie Ihr eigenes:
- Beginnen Sie mit SKILL.md in „.claude/skills/your-skill/“.
- Definieren Sie eine klare Rolle und einen klaren Kontext
- Geben Sie konkrete Beispiele an
- Testen und iterieren
- Teilen Sie es mit Ihrem Team
Die Wiederholungssteuer ist optional. Fähigkeiten sind die Rückerstattung.
🤝 Stellen Sie ein / arbeiten Sie mit mir zusammen:
Benötigen Sie Hilfe bei benutzerdefinierten KI-Integrationen, der Entwicklung von Claude-Fähigkeiten oder der Leistungsoptimierung? Für Beratung und individuelle Projekte stehe ich zur Verfügung:
- 🔗 Fiverr (benutzerdefinierte Builds, Integrationen, Leistung): fiverr.com/s/EgxYmWD
- 🌐 Persönliches Mejba-Portfolio: mejba.me
- 🏢 Ramlit Limited: ramlit.com
- 🎨 ColorPark-Kreativagentur: colorpark.io
- 🛡 xCyberSecurity Global Services: xcybersecurity.io
Egal, ob Sie auf Ihr Team zugeschnittene Claude-Kenntnisse, KI-Workflow-Automatisierung oder Full-Stack-Entwicklung mit KI-Integration benötigen, lassen Sie uns reden!